The Future of Intelligent Movement
What sets autonomous robots apart is their ability to “see” and think. Equipped with sensors, cameras, and mapping tools, they can detect obstacles, calculate the safest routes, and move goods without bumping into workers or equipment. This smart navigation system ensures that every movement is efficient and safe. The technology keeps improving every year, making robots more adaptable to different types of warehouses. From food storage to manufacturing, their impact can already be seen across many industries.

Building the Palletized Automated Warehouse
The next big step in warehouse innovation is the palletized automated warehouse. In this setup, every item is stored, sorted, and transported on pallets that robots can move with ease. The system uses sensors and software to track goods, manage inventory, and optimize storage space. It’s a perfect blend of data and motion, creating an ecosystem where everything connects seamlessly. Workers can focus on planning and oversight while robots handle the heavy tasks. This not only boosts output but also reduces waste and downtime.
